The Galaxy S20 Ultra features a massive 6.9-inch, 120Hz AMOLED display, Snapdragon 865 CPU, 12GB of RAM, and 128GB of storage. On the rear you'll find four lenses: 108MP wide (ƒ/1.8), 48MP telephoto (ƒ/3.5), 12MP ultrawide (ƒ/2.2), and time-of-flight VGA.
In our Galaxy S20 Ultra review, we loved the phone's gorgeous 120Hz display, which looked phenomenal and covered 231.1% of the sRGB color space. By comparison, that far exceeds the iPhone 11 Pro Max's 118.6%. The iPhone 11 Pro Max is a smidge brighter, however.
In terms of performance, the S20 Ultra is equipped to handle everything from ordinary multitasking to the most demanding mobile titles, like Fortnite and Asphalt 9 Legends.
